Production and partial characterization of serine and metallo peptidases secreted by Aspergillus fumigatus Fresenius in submerged and solid state fermentatio

Abstract: Enzyme production varies in different fermentation systems. Enzyme expression in different fermentation systems yields important information for improving our understanding of enzymatic production induction. Comparative studies between solid-state fermentation (SSF) using agro-industrial waste wheat bran and submerged fermentation (SmF) using synthetic media were carried out to determinate the best parameters for peptidase production by the fungus Aspergillus fumigatus Fresen. “…Similarly, peptidase production by Aspergillus fumigatus in SSF using wheat bran and SmF using casein as a substrate was compared. An improved yield of peptidase production, approximately 30 times higher, was obtained through SSF compared to SmF [115]. In another comparative study among SSF, slurry state fermentation (SlSF) and SmF, revealed that maximum β-xylosidase was obtained in SSF (33.7 U·mL −1 ) followed by SlSF (24.9 U·mL −1 ) and SmF (5.5 U·mL −1 ) [129].…”
